What is Laser Printing?

Laser printing is a type of digital printing technology that uses a laser beam to transfer images or text onto paper. The laser beam is directed by a scanner or a rotating mirror onto a photosensitive drum that attracts toner particles.

The toner particles are then transferred onto the paper and fused with heat to create the final printed output.

Advantages of Laser Printing

Laser printing offers several advantages over other printing technologies, including:

  1. High-Quality Output: Laser printing produces sharp, clear, and precise text and images, making it an ideal choice for printing professional documents, marketing materials, and photographs.
  2. Fast Printing Speed: Laser printers can print multiple pages per minute, making them ideal for high-volume printing jobs.
  3. Low Maintenance Costs: Laser printers have fewer moving parts and require less frequent maintenance compared to inkjet printers, reducing their long-term operating costs.
  4. Versatility: Laser printers can print on a wide range of paper types and sizes, making them suitable for various printing applications.
  5. Cost-Effective: While laser printers are typically more expensive than inkjet printers, they offer a lower cost per page, making them a cost-effective printing solution in the long run.

Types of Laser Printers

There are two main types of laser printers: monochrome and color.

  1. Monochrome Laser Printers: Monochrome laser printers are designed to print black-and-white documents and images. They are ideal for printing text-heavy documents, such as contracts, reports, and manuals.
  2. Color Laser Printers: Color laser printers are designed to print documents and images in full color. They are ideal for printing marketing materials, presentations, and photographs.

Factors to Consider When Buying a Laser Printer

When choosing a laser printer, there are several factors to consider, including:

  1. Printing Speed: The printing speed of a laser printer is measured in pages per minute (ppm). Consider the printing speed you need based on your printing volume.
  2. Print Quality: The print quality of a laser printer is measured in dots per inch (dpi). The higher the dpi, the better the print quality. Consider the print quality you need based on the type of documents you plan to print.
  3. Paper Handling: Consider the paper size and weight that the printer can handle. If you plan to print on heavy cardstock or envelopes, make sure the printer can handle those paper types.
  4. Connectivity: Consider the connectivity options available on the printer, such as Wi-Fi, Ethernet, and USB. Choose a printer that offers the connectivity you need for your devices.
  5. Price: Laser printers vary in price, so consider your budget when choosing a printer. Keep in mind that higher-priced printers usually offer more features and higher printing speeds.

Maintenance Tips for Laser Printers

To keep your laser printer in top condition and extend its lifespan, follow these maintenance tips:

  1. Keep it Clean: Regularly clean the printer’s exterior and interior to remove dust, toner particles, and other debris.
  2. Replace Consumables: Replace the toner cartridge, drum unit, and other consumables when they run out or reach their end of life.
  3. Update Firmware: Check for firmware updates and install them to improve the printer’s performance and fix any bugs.
